在线编程游戏是什么

fiy 其他 2

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在线编程游戏是一种结合了游戏和编程的教育工具。它通过提供一个互动的游戏环境,让玩家通过编写代码来解决游戏中的问题和挑战。这种游戏不仅可以帮助玩家学习编程语言和技能,还可以锻炼他们的逻辑思维和问题解决能力。

    在在线编程游戏中,玩家通常扮演一个角色,需要完成一系列的任务或解决难题。他们可以通过编写程序代码来控制角色的行为,从而完成游戏中的各种挑战。游戏通常会提供一个虚拟的编程环境,如代码编辑器、调试器和运行时模拟器,以帮助玩家编写和测试他们的代码。

    在线编程游戏通常会提供不同的难度级别,从初学者到专业开发人员都能找到适合自己的挑战。有些游戏还提供学习资料和教程,帮助玩家学习相关的编程知识和技巧。

    通过在线编程游戏,玩家可以在趣味的游戏环境中学习编程。相比传统的编程学习方式,如教科书和课堂,这种游戏方式更加互动和实践导向。玩家可以在真实的应用场景中应用他们学到的知识,加深对编程原理和概念的理解。

    此外,在线编程游戏还为玩家提供了一个学习和交流的平台。玩家可以通过在线社区与其他玩家分享和讨论编程经验,互相学习和帮助。这种社区活动可以扩展玩家的视野,激发他们的创造力和合作精神。

    总的来说,在线编程游戏是一种有趣而有效的编程学习工具。它既能够提高玩家的编程技能,又能够培养他们的逻辑思维和问题解决能力。同时,它还为玩家提供了一个与他人学习和交流的平台,促进了合作和创新。如果你对编程感兴趣,不妨尝试一下在线编程游戏,享受学习的乐趣吧!

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在线编程游戏是一种通过互联网平台提供的游戏,旨在帮助玩家学习和提高编程技能。这些游戏通常提供了一个虚拟的编程环境,玩家可以在其中编写代码,并通过解决各种难题和挑战来进一步培养自己的编程能力。以下是在线编程游戏的一些特点和优势:

    1. 互动性:在线编程游戏提供了一个与其他玩家互动的平台。玩家可以通过与其他玩家合作或竞争来解决问题和完成任务,这种互动性帮助玩家提高解决问题的能力,并学习到不同的编程技巧和方法。

    2. 学习趣味性:在线编程游戏通常以有趣和富有挑战性的方式呈现编程任务。这些任务往往涉及到一系列的问题和难题,玩家需要运用逻辑思维和编程技巧来解决。这种趣味性有助于激发玩家的学习兴趣并提高他们的学习动力。

    3. 实践机会:在线编程游戏提供了一个实际练习编程技能的机会。玩家可以在一个安全的虚拟环境中编写代码并进行测试,不必担心错误会对现实世界产生负面影响。这种实践机会让玩家能够不断尝试和犯错,从中学习和改进。

    4. 自主学习:在线编程游戏允许玩家按照自己的节奏学习。玩家可以选择完成不同的任务和挑战,根据自己的兴趣和学习进度进行学习。这种自主学习的方式可以使玩家更加主动地参与学习过程,并提高他们的学习效果。

    5. 社区支持:在线编程游戏通常有一个活跃的社区。玩家可以与其他编程爱好者交流和分享经验,寻求帮助和反馈。社区支持可以帮助玩家解决问题、扩展知识和建立联系,同时也提供了一种互相激励和学习的机会。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在线编程游戏是一种结合了游戏和编程的学习方式。通过这种游戏形式,玩家可以通过解决各种编程问题和挑战来学习编程知识和技能。在线编程游戏通常提供了一个虚拟环境,玩家可以使用不同的编程语言和工具来完成任务和解决问题。

    在线编程游戏的目的是通过游戏化的方式吸引更多的人参与编程学习,尤其是对初学者来说,这种互动的学习方式可以更加有趣和吸引人。此外,通过在线编程游戏,玩家还可以与其他玩家进行互动、合作和竞赛,从而提高自己的编程能力和解决问题的能力。

    接下来,我将从方法、操作流程等方面讲解在线编程游戏的具体内容。

    一、选择合适的在线编程游戏平台
    首先,玩家需要选择适合自己的在线编程游戏平台。常见的在线编程游戏平台包括Codecademy、Codewars、LeetCode等。这些平台提供了不同难度和类型的编程题目和任务,玩家可以根据自己的编程能力选择合适的平台和游戏。

    二、注册账号并登录
    在选择好平台后,玩家需要注册一个账号并登录。通常,注册账号是免费的,玩家可以使用自己的电子邮箱或者第三方账号(如Google、GitHub等)进行注册。

    三、选择编程语言和工具
    接下来,玩家需要选择自己熟悉或者想要学习的编程语言和工具。常见的编程语言包括Python、Java、JavaScript等,平台通常提供了多种编程语言的支持。此外,玩家还可以根据自己的需求选择不同的编程工具,如文本编辑器、集成开发环境等。

    四、完成编程题目和任务
    在登录平台后,玩家可以开始完成各种编程题目和任务。这些题目和任务通常按照难度和类型分类,并且提供了相应的说明和提示。玩家可以根据自己的能力和兴趣选择适合自己的题目,并尝试解决问题。

    五、学习和提高编程技能
    在线编程游戏不仅可以帮助玩家学习和理解编程知识,还可以提高玩家的编程技能和解决问题的能力。在完成题目和任务的过程中,玩家可以通过不断尝试、调试和优化代码来提高自己的编程能力,并且可以从其他玩家的解答中学习到不同的思路和方法。

    六、与其他玩家互动、合作和竞赛
    很多在线编程游戏平台还提供了与其他玩家互动、合作和竞赛的功能。玩家可以加入不同的编程社区、组织和团队,与其他玩家交流分享自己的编程经验和解决问题的方法。此外,玩家还可以参加各种编程竞赛和挑战,通过与其他玩家的比拼来提升自己的编程能力。

    总结起来,在线编程游戏是一种有趣、互动和有效的编程学习方式。通过游戏化的形式,玩家可以在解决问题和挑战的过程中学习和提高编程技能,并与其他玩家互动、合作和竞赛,从而更好地掌握编程知识和技能。在线编程游戏不仅适合初学者入门学习,也适合有一定编程基础的玩家继续提高和拓展自己的编程能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部